Overview

Seward Military Resort is an MWR facility at Seward, Alaska, offering accommodations for active duty, veterans, and their families. The resort sits near Resurrection Bay and supports RV, yurt, and tent stays. RV and tent check-in starts at 1 pm; check-out is at noon. Room check-in is after 3 pm with an 11 am check-out. Fishing is the main draw here. The surrounding Alaskan waters give you access to some of the most productive fishing in the country. The resort also connects guests to tours and outdoor activities in the region, including kayaking and boat tours. Access is limited to U.S. Armed Forces members and their families — bring your DoD ID. Important Info

RV sites (water/electric/cable, no sewer — dump station on-site) open roughly mid-May through September 30 (dates vary slightly by source — confirm current season). Sites arranged parking-lot style with minimal privacy. Reservations recommended, up to 1 year ahead; cancellations inside 7 days incur a fee. Open to active duty, National Guard, Reserve, retired military, DoD civilians, veterans with a VA disability rating above 5%, and sponsored guests. Call (907) 224-2659 to reserve.
